Closely mirroring Michael Jordan’s last shot; Kawhi Leonard laced up the Air Jordan 5 for his own clutch moment in the latter part of the 2015-16 NBA season.
With the score tied 96 all, the ball was inbounded to Leonard near mid-court with 13 seconds left on the game-clock. Much like MJ, Kawhi stared down a young Aaron Gordon as he methodically dribbled down the clock. The Klaw kept the young Magic forward honest with a left-to-right cross, before freezing Gordon on a right-to-left. The hesitation gave Kawhi just enough space to rise up and float a mid-range jumper. Swish.
Leonard rocked the Air Jordan 5 for this clutch moment. This classic shoe features the iconic visible Air unit in the heel, as well as eye catching details like a reflective tongue and unique lace lock.
